This time it is Clarins Tonic Bath & Shower Concentrate (better in the bath than the shower in my view) that is a stalwart of the Clarins Body range for very good reason.
It’s got a superbly mind clearing scent – rosemary, mint and geranium – that is rather earthy and soothing. If you ever use bath-time as ‘therapy’ then it’s just about perfect because the scent reminds me of spas: clean, aromatherapy-ish and relaxing. It’s not super bubbly but you can use it on a wash cloth and it gives a light lather for cleaning. The main thing, though, is that it feels like a proper treat. It’s not necessary, it’s not a must-have but it is most certainly a lovely-have! And we all need lovely-haves every now and again. You can find it HERE for £18.
